Annamalai University MBBS Cutoff 2024 was released on the basis of NEET scores. The cutoff was released in the form of opening and closing ranks. For the General AI category candidates, the last-round closing rank was 17596. Therefore, it is possible to get into Annamalai University at 15000 rank for MBBS admission.

The cut-off for NEET for admission to government medical colleges depends on several factors, including the number of seats available, the number of candidates appearing for the exam, the difficulty level of the exam, and the previous year's admission record.The minimum marks required in NEET for MBBS in government colleges for the general and EWS categories are 720-164 and 163-129 for SC/ST/OBC categories

SRM Medical College NEET UG cutoff 2024 has been released for admission to MBBS, BDS, BSc Nursing, and other medical/paramedical courses in India. As per the Round 1 Seat Allotment Result, the SRM Medical College MBBS cutoff 2024 is 637582 for the students belonging to the General AI category. Comparing the latest year cutoff with the past two years, the institute saw inconsistency in the closing ranks over the years for its MBBS course. The Round 1 cutoff for the MBBS course was 744166 in 2023. The General AI quota, the NEET UG Round 1 cutoff 2024 for the MBBS course was 637582.

The NEET 2024 cut off has been revised along with the scores and final answer keys.The cut off marks have been reduced by two marks.The number of candidates qualifying the exam has also been revised.       UR/EWS      - cut off score 720 -160.   OBC             - cut off score  161-127.         SC                - cut off score  161-127.

RUHS College of Dental Science NEET UG Cutoff was released for different categories under the AI and the HS quota. As per the cutoff list, the cutoff rank for the General AI category to get BDS was 14991. Therefore, the chances of getting BDS with this score is low if one belong to the General AI category. However, for the OBC AI catdegpry candidates, it is possible to get BDS admission with this score, as the cutoff rank for this category is 22122.

AIIMS Mangalagiri NEET UG Cutoff 2024 was released for Round 1. The Cutoff was released for different categories under the AI and HS quota. As per the cutoff, the closing rank for the General AI category candidates was 1836. For the OBC AI category candiates, the cutoff rank to get MBBS was 3214

Pandit Bhagwat Dayal Sharma University of Health Sciences accepts NEET UG scores for admission to the MBBS course. The PBDSUHS MBBS Cutoff was released for Round 1. The Cutoff was released for different categories under the AI and the HS quota. The Cutoff rank for the General AI category was 3843. During PBDSUHS NEET UG Cutoff 2023, the cutoff rank for the MBBS course was 23337. The Cutoff rank to get MBBS admission in 2022 was 9111, for the General AI category. Considering the Cutoff ranks for the current year and the previous two years, the competition has witnessed a fluctuating trend.
